Secure Network Connections Work: Encryption, Tunneling, and Anonymity
VPNs provide a degree of protection by encrypting your internet traffic. Imagine your data as a package that needs to be sent securely. A VPN acts like an envelope around this data, converting it into an jumbled format read more that only the intended recipient can decode. This encryption occurs within a private connection, which channels your traffic through a remote server.
This location acts as an proxy between you and the websites or applications you're using. Your actual identity is masked, so platforms only see the location of the VPN server. This adds a layer of secrecy.
Understanding VPNs: A Comprehensive Guide
In today's digital world, protection is more important than ever. A Virtual Private Network (VPN) encrypts your internet connection, creating a private tunnel between your device and the website or server you're accessing. This prevents others from tracking your online activity, allowing you to browse the internet privately.
There are many causes why you should consider using a VPN. Several common advantages include: using geo-restricted content, defending your data on public Wi-Fi networks, and enhancing your online security.
